Keeping your flowers fresh and beautiful for as long as possible requires a few simple but important care steps. Start by using clean, fresh water in your flower vase and be sure to change it every two days to prevent bacteria buildup, which can shorten the life of your blooms. When trimming the stems, always cut them diagonally with sharp scissors or a knife; this technique allows the flowers to absorb water more efficiently and stay hydrated longer. It’s also crucial to keep your flowers away from direct sunlight and heat sources, especially in warmer climates such as Cyprus or Bahrain, where excessive heat can cause them to wilt prematurely. For delicate flowers like hydrangeas or lilies, lightly misting their petals with water can help maintain their moisture and keep them looking perky and vibrant. By following these care tips, you can ensure that your bouquet continues to brighten any room and bring joy for many days after delivery.
